3rd-9th March 2008 On December 2nd 2007, actress and activist, Mia Farrow, launched Fund4Darfur, a new initiative of Aegis Trust to support survivors of the crisis in Darfur.

From the 3rd to the 9th of March, a week of fundraising events will mark Fund4Darfur week, being held to raise money to support survivors of
rape, torture and mass atrocities from Darfur. Our target is £30,000. If
you have an idea or are interested in fundraising, please get in touch
and we’ll assist you and send you a fundraising pack.
